Transaction 41aecf2e3ab0ddff39dcfa9dbfe27849ab6051f19798166bfc84ff939a2f332d

3 Input
1 Outputs
  • 41aecf2e3ab0ddff39dcfa9dbfe27849ab6051f19798166bfc84ff939a2f332d:0
  • value  1118004
    address  38dKZtoZoP9CuXo7aAsP8aydu5BKkx5puC